What is a LCSW?
LCSW represents licensed clinical social worker. They are social workers who have gone on to acquire their master’s in social work (MSW) and complete the requirements in their state to get their professional license. By obtaining their MSW and license, they can operate in a variety of environments, explore various specializations, and even open their own personal practice.

What does a Licensed Medical Social Worker Do?
A certified medical social worker provides treatment to clients with mental and psychological issuesExternal link: open_in_new that are affecting their daily lives. They deal with their customers to listen to their requirements and offer the support and resources needed to manage those problems.

LCSWs also have the capability to identify and treat the concerns of their clients, although this may differ by state. This can be in the form of supplying treatment, offering recommendations, and dealing with other experts like physicians to come up with a reliable treatment plan for their client.

Where do LCSWs work?
LCSWs can work in an array of settings. Some operate in offices for research study purposes, and others might visit their clients in schools, their home, community centers, health centers, assisted living facilities, and more. The workplace of an LCSW varies depending on their area of specialization.

Is a LCSW considered a doctor?
LCSWs have the ability to provide psychotherapy to their clients, however, their training focuses on linking their customers with the resources and abilities needed to fulfill their needs. LCSWs can easily team up with doctors and psychiatrists to develop detailed treatment strategies for clients.

While those in the field of psychiatry can go on to medical school and make their Medical professional of Medicine, the master’s in social work (MSW) is the highest level of education that LCSWs get. Depending on an LCSW’s career objectives, they might decide to finish a DSW program down the line.

Just how much does a LCSW make?
As of May 2020, the typical annual wage for social workers was $51,760 External link: open_in_new, according to the BLS. The wage of an LCSW differs based upon aspects such as their employer, specialized, and the quantity of time they work. Many social workers tend to work full-time, however some might be on call.

A psychologist is a social researcher who is trained to study human habits and psychological procedures. Psychologists can work in a range of research study or clinical settings. Psychology degrees are offered at all levels: bachelor’s, master’s, or doctorate (PhD or PsyD). Advanced degrees and licensing are required for those in independent practice or who offer patient care, including scientific, counseling and school psychologists.

PhD programs in clinical psychology highlight theory and research study methods and prepare students for either academic work or careers as practitioners. The PsyD, which was developed in the late 1960s to deal with a shortage of practitioners, stresses training in therapy and therapy. Psychologists with either degree can practice treatment but are required to complete numerous years of supervised practice prior to becoming licensed.

A psychologist will identify a mental disorder or issue and identify what’s best for the client’s care. A psychologist frequently works in tandem with a psychiatrist, who is likewise a medical physician and can recommend medication if it is figured out that medication is necessary for a patient’s treatment. Psychologists can do research study, which is an extremely important contribution academically and medically, to the profession.

A therapist is a more comprehensive umbrella term for specialists who are trained– and frequently certified– to supply a variety of treatments and rehabilitation for people. Therapists can be psychoanalysts, marital relationship counselors, social workers and life coaches, among other specialties. A therapist’s objective is to assist clients make decisions and clarify their feelings in order to fix issues. Therapists offer assistance and guidance, while assisting patients make effective decisions within the total structure of assistance. When picking a therapist, their education, licensing and expert qualifications ought to be important considerations.
